Output 670a34ce4293d73452926b2a5091b7ed4372e68dfd443eac13da82e017ee6a9e:0

value
266562
script pubkey
OP_HASH160 OP_PUSHBYTES_20 12e473920d5fbd1bcb7eb3b055837a66b086c50a OP_EQUAL
address
33Qum5gYG2wdfA6K37U82TNBNKiQLL5Mg2
transaction
670a34ce4293d73452926b2a5091b7ed4372e68dfd443eac13da82e017ee6a9e
confirmations
165728
spent
true